> When I turn on pjsip history I get segfaults.  The thread that faults is:
> {noformat}
> #0  0x00007f9e507f736a in sprint_list_entry (entry=entry at entry=0x7f9e30b4d8b0, line=line at entry=0x7f9e70676590 "\340ggp\236\177", len=256) at res_pjsip_history.c:669
> #1  0x00007f9e507f8435 in history_on_rx_msg (rdata=<optimized out>) at res_pjsip_history.c:763
> #2  0x00007f9e9cd94167 in pjsip_endpt_process_rx_data (endpt=endpt at entry=0x27cbf88, rdata=rdata at entry=0x7f9e90096e78, p=p at entry=0x7f9e70676780, p_handled=p_handled at entry=0x7f9e70676770) at ../src/pjsip/sip_endpoint.c:893
> #3  0x00007f9e9cd9432e in endpt_on_rx_msg (endpt=0x27cbf88, status=<optimized out>, rdata=0x7f9e90096e78) at ../src/pjsip/sip_endpoint.c:1043
> #4  0x00007f9e9cd9b9c2 in pjsip_tpmgr_receive_packet (mgr=<optimized out>, rdata=rdata at entry=0x7f9e90096e78) at ../src/pjsip/sip_transport.c:2026
> #5  0x00007f9e9cd9ddd0 in udp_on_read_complete (key=0x7f9e70a8da40, op_key=<optimized out>, bytes_read=869) at ../src/pjsip/sip_transport_udp.c:191
> #6  0x00007f9e9ce14ffc in ioqueue_dispatch_read_event (ioqueue=ioqueue at entry=0x7f9e70a8d0a0, h=h at entry=0x7f9e70a8da40) at ../src/pj/ioqueue_common_abs.c:605
> #7  0x00007f9e9ce16710 in pj_ioqueue_poll (ioqueue=0x7f9e70a8d0a0, timeout=timeout at entry=0x7f9e70676d40) at ../src/pj/ioqueue_epoll.c:720
> #8  0x00007f9e9cd93e98 in pjsip_endpt_handle_events2 (endpt=0x27cbf88, max_timeout=max_timeout at entry=0x7f9e70676d90, p_count=p_count at entry=0x0) at ../src/pjsip/sip_endpoint.c:744
> #9  0x00007f9e9cd93f57 in pjsip_endpt_handle_events (endpt=<optimized out>, max_timeout=max_timeout at entry=0x7f9e70676d90) at ../src/pjsip/sip_endpoint.c:776
> #10 0x00007f9e7b5ae628 in monitor_thread_exec (endpt=<optimized out>) at res_pjsip.c:4512
> #11 0x00007f9e9ce17ae0 in thread_main (param=0x27cb7b8) at ../src/pj/os_core_unix.c:541
> #12 0x00007f9e9b3b5dd5 in start_thread (arg=0x7f9e70677700) at pthread_create.c:307
> #13 0x00007f9e9a986ead in clone () at ../s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/x86_64/clone.S:111
> {noformat}
